ORA-19616: output filename must be specified if database not
mounted
Answer / guest
Cause: A datafile restore specified no target filename, but
the database is not mounted. The database must be mounted
when no target filename is specified, so that the target
filename can be obtained from the controlfile.
Action: The restore conversation remains active. If you wish
to restore datafiles without their target filenames, then
mount the datbase before continuing. Otherwise, a target
filename must be specified on all datafile restoration calls.
